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60062111227 5545763857 53859 552968311
91 805003 091
91 805003 091
3168 168 83080897748
All about undefined
Interested in learning more?
91 805003 091
3168 168 83080897748
See more
681 7961
01867210 6464923890 34 931043582
See more
089677202 7293955582 73126004
86472 075312 54458200324 0405
See more